Is it possible to score 2 points after scoring a touchdown in football? If yes, how can this be achieved?

Yes, it is possible to score 2 points after scoring a touchdown in football. This is known as a "two-point conversion." There are two ways to achieve a two-point conversion:

  1. Run or pass the ball into the end zone. This is the most common way to score a two-point conversion. The offense has one play to advance the ball into the end zone.
